What it is, How it works

Scanning hair is increasingly recognized as a robust means of identifying drug and alcohol use. It offers a prolonged historical overview of alcohol and drug exposure by ensnaring biomarkers within the expanding strands of hair. When procured near the scalp, hair offers nearly a three-month window to detect alcohol and other drugs. Hair collection is straightforward, fairly resistant to tampering, and easily shippable.

A 1.5-inch segment comprising roughly 200 hair strands (comparable to a #2 pencil diameter) closest to the scalp yields 100mg of hair, which is the optimal sample size for both screening and confirmation. For EtG, supplemental tests, or analyses exceeding 10 panels, a 150mg specimen is suggested. Utilizing a jeweler's scale for specimen weighing is advisable. Absent scalp hair, an equivalent volume of body hair may be utilized. When specifying head hair, we refer solely to scalp hair. Body hair encompasses all other hair types (such as facial and axillary hair).

Process Overview

The laboratory procedure for processing drug test results comprises four primary stages: Accessioning, Screening, Extraction, and Confirmation.

Accessioning entails the preliminary handling of a sample within a laboratory's framework. This phase ensures the sample's proper sealing and shipment, correlates it with a LAN (Laboratory Accessioning Number), and fulfills any remaining data input absent from an electronic chain of custody arrangement.

Screening conducts a preliminary rapid assessment for drugs of abuse. Although Screening serves as an economical method to negate drug use in most samples, court admissibility necessitates a confirmation of positive screens. Presumptively positive samples from Screening mandate further verification.

These presumptively positive samples from Screening undergo additional hair extraction and preparation for Extraction. Here, the concentration of drugs extracted from hair is significantly lower than other methods (e.g., urine or oral fluid), posing challenges that make hair drug screening a sophisticated methodology.

Confirmation of positives detected during screening is executed via GC/MS, GC/MS/MS, or LC/MS/MS. Prior to confirmation, all presumptive positive samples undergo necessary cleaning. The complete laboratory cycle, from Accessioning through Confirmation, adheres to both the CAP (College of American Pathologists) Hair accreditation and ISO / IEC 17025 standards.

Advantages of hair drug testing:

  • Extensive detection period: Hair drug tests reveal drug use over a span of 90 days, unlike shorter-span urine tests.
  • High resistance to deception: The likelihood of manipulation in a hair drug test is minimal, ensuring more precise results.
  • Chronological use patterns: It highlights drug usage trends over time rather than just recent consumption.

Limitations:

  • Recent use detection gap: It usually takes around 5-7 days for drugs to become traceable in hair.
  • Expense: Hair drug tests typically incur higher costs compared to alternative testing methods.
  • Result variability: Drug metabolite concentrations in hair can be influenced by factors such as hair color and individual growth disparities.

Note: Frequently misnamed as "hair follicle tests", the examination focuses on the hair strand rather than the follicle beneath the scalp.

What's New In Hair Follicle Drug Testing according to the Hair Drug Testing Experts

With its multidisciplinary nature, hair testing brings together researchers, scientists, and experts from various domains to develop innovative techniques, explore new methodologies, and address emerging concerns, responding to the ever-evolving challenges of drug abuse, therapeutic drug monitoring, and environmental exposures to pollutants.

The joint meeting of the Society of Hair Testing (SoHT) and the Italian Group of Forensic Toxicologists (GTFI) was organized in Verona, June 8–10, 2022, and hosted by the Legal Medicine team of the Verona University Hospital, directed by Franco Tagliaro together with Federica Bortolotti and Rossella Gottardo.

It served as a prominent platform for knowledge exchange and collaboration, facilitating groundbreaking advancements in hair testing and analysis. In this special issue of Drug Testing and Analysis, we aim to showcase the remarkable manuscripts presented at this significant event, shedding light on the latest research and highlighting the future directions in this field.

Novel Analytical Techniques: The Verona meeting witnessed the unveiling of cutting-edge analytical techniques, offering enhanced sensitivity, selectivity, and accuracy for drug testing. Remarkable advancements in sample preparation, detection, and identification of drug compounds have been presented. The manuscripts in this section presented novel approaches, such as multianalyte methods and on-line preparation which can enable rapid analysis and improve thorough forensic investigations.

Biomarkers and Pharmacokinetics: The identification and validation of reliable biomarkers and pharmacokinetic studies are fundamental aspects of drug testing and analysis. The impact of hair treatments on the oxidation/decomposition of drugs in hair was also explored, as the long-term fate of drugs incorporated in the keratin matrix. Furthermore, the SoHT meeting in Verona featured research on the identification and quantification of alcohol abuse biomarkers, their stability, and their correlation with exposure and other biomarkers.

Forensic Applications and Interpretation: One of the vital objectives of hair testing is its application in forensic investigations and legal proceedings. The SoHT meeting in Verona emphasized the significance of rigorous interpretation of analytical results and the need for standardized protocols. Manuscripts in this section present advancements in forensic toxicology, and have explored the challenges posed by emerging designer drugs and strategies to combat their proliferation. The pitfalls encountered when the exogenous/endogenous nature of a substance is questioned were presented and discussed. The special issue presents also manuscripts that delve into the ethical implications of drug testing in drug facilitated sexual assaults.

Clinical Applications of hair testing are witnessed by the insight on environmental tobacco smoke exposure, assessed by hair analysis in a population of students and the study of in utero-exposure to drugs of abuse through neonatal hair analysis. Exposure to drugs was also important in cases of child abuse/neglect, when the clinical purpose of hair testing merge with its forensic applications.

The legal framework surrounding hair testing and the achievement of guidelines to ensure fairness, accuracy, and confidentiality in drug testing practices have also been discussed,and the SoHT consensus on general hair testing and testing for drugs of abuse was presented at the meeting and published as a Letter to the Editor.

Frequently Asked Questions

A hair follicle drug test analyzes a small sample of hair to detect a history of drug use over time. Because drug metabolites are incorporated into hair as it grows, this method can show patterns of use instead of just recent exposure. It is frequently used for legal and court requirements, long-term monitoring, and high-trust workforce screening.
Standard hair drug testing typically reflects drug use over approximately a 90-day period, based on the length of hair collected at the time of testing. Longer hair can sometimes reflect a longer time frame, and extremely short hair can reduce that window.
Hair drug testing commonly screens for marijuana/THC, cocaine, opiates/opioids, amphetamines/methamphetamines, and PCP. In many cases, additional expanded panels may be requested to include other substances.
